23. Ordinary people, ordinary lives
Podcast: Download (Duration: 33:06 — 30.3MB)
Mike speaks with Jon Bernie whose awakening at the age of 16 ignited a spiritual journey exploring Zen, Vipassana and Advaita. He studied with teachers such as Jean Klein, Robert Adams, Papaji and Adyashanti who in 2002 asked Jon to teach. Supported by the Clear Water Sangha Jon offers regular classes and retreats in the San Francisco Bay Area and beyond.
